Warnings and Messages Displayed on LCD Monitor (continued)
CARD
PROTECTED
The SD Memory Card is write-protected.
FOLDER ERROR
There are no free folders on the SD Memory Card
to copy image data to.
RECREATE DPOF
FILE?
There is a parameter that is not supported in the DPOF
setting file.
FRAME NUMBER
FULL
The maximum number of images (999 frames) that can
be set is exceeded when setting DPOF setting files.
NO IMAGE
AVAILABLE
No images are recorded to the SD Memory Card
DPOF ERROR
There is a parameter that is not supported in the DPOF
setting file.
DPOF PROTECT
OFF
This is a confirmation for checking whether or not to
remove DPOF write-protection when clearing DPOF
settings.
You tried to play back an image not supported on this
camera.
ERROR ***
THIS CARD CAN'T
NOT BE USED
A camera problem has occurred.
Contact a Support Center.
Image files is over 16348 pieces.
Existing SD Memory Card capacity
is over 256 MB.
